Meanwhile, in the world of music, how about that supergroup of James Cargill, Roj Stevens (Broadcast) and Julian House? Supergroup? What am I talking about? There's not a double-neck guitar or permed hairdo in sight, as far as I know. Still it's a 'super' group, isn't it? Maybe not. Anyway, the pooled talents of Children Of Alice in theory should make a great album...and to my surprise, have. I say 'great', although the common tropes (admittedly mostly created by House) of the haunty thing are well-worn by now. That said, Children Of Alice is still a charming trip down the rabbit hole of magical absurdities that's skillfully stitched together and skips around the toy shop of sounds designed to evoke funfair horror and frolics.
